Summary

The Research Engineer - Mechatronics is a hands-on engineering role within the TaylorMade Research & Development team, focused on the design, prototyping, integration, and validation of electromechanical systems that advance golf equipment and player performance. This role demands deep practical expertise in mechatronics, sensor systems, electronic hardware, wiring, and embedded controls, combined with the ability to develop supporting software and user-facing tools. The ideal candidate is a builder and problem-solver who thrives in a laboratory and prototype environment, producing functional systems from concept through deployment.

Essential Functions and Key Responsibilities:
  • Design, prototype, wire, assemble, and test mechatronic and electromechanical systems used in golf equipment evaluation, performance measurement, and product development
  • Develop and interpret wiring diagrams, schematics, and electrical specifications for custom hardware assemblies, test rigs, and IoT-connected devices
  • Select, integrate, and characterize sensors (IMUs, load cells, encoders, pressure sensors, optical sensors, etc.) - including defining operating limits, calibration procedures, and signal conditioning requirements
  • Design and implement IoT systems and wireless data acquisition platforms that capture real-time performance data from equipment and players
  • Develop embedded firmware and control software for microcontrollers and microprocessors (e.g., Arduino, Raspberry Pi, STM32 or similar) to drive test automation and data capture systems
  • Write clean, maintainable code to interface with hardware, process sensor data, and build internal and user-facing applications and interfaces; leverage AI-assisted development tools to accelerate prototyping and automate test routines; apply basic computer vision techniques to support equipment and player performance analysis
  • Define and communicate technical requirements and specifications effectively across multiple disciplines including research, development, engineering, legal, and external partners / suppliers; document designs thoroughly including schematics, BOMs, test protocols, and calibration records
  • Performs other related duties and assignments as required.

Knowledge and Skills Requirements:
  • Expert-level understanding of electromechanical systems - integrating mechanical structures, electrical circuits, actuators, sensors, and controllers into cohesive working prototypes
  • Proficiency in reading and creating wiring diagrams, electrical schematics, and PCB layouts
  • Hands-on experience with sensor selection, integration, calibration, and characterization - including noise floors, bandwidth, dynamic range, operating limits, and environmental constraints
  • Experience with IoT architectures and wireless communication protocols (BLE, Wi-Fi, Zigbee, LoRa, MQTT) and embedded data transmission systems
  • Proficiency with prototyping tools and bench instrumentation: breadboarding, soldering, oscilloscopes, multimeters, signal generators, and data acquisition systems
  • Strong programming skills in embedded C/C++ for microcontroller firmware, and Python or MATLAB for data processing, test automation, and hardware interfacing; working knowledge of computer vision libraries (e.g., OpenCV) for image and video-based analysis
  • Demonstrated ability to build user-facing applications or interfaces - desktop GUIs, web dashboards, or mobile apps - to present hardware data and system status; practical use of AI coding tools and LLM-assisted development workflows
  • Familiarity with mechanical CAD (CREO or similar) sufficient to design sensor mounts, fixtures, and enclosures
  • Strong communication, presentation, and interpersonal skills; ability to work cross-functionally across research, engineering, and commercial teams; knowledge of the game of golf, golf equipment, and golf biomechanics strongly preferred
